The field of Radio Frequency (RF) and Microwave Engineering has a rich history, evolving from early experiments in electromagnetism to the sophisticated wireless technologies we use today. Key milestones include:
Today, RF and Microwave Engineering continues to evolve, driven by the demand for faster, more reliable wireless communication and sensing technologies. Research areas include millimeter-wave communication, 5G/6G, and advanced radar systems.

An M.Tech in Radio Frequency and Microwave Engineering opens doors to lucrative career opportunities in India. Salary trends are influenced by factors like experience, skills, and the specific industry. Fresh graduates can expect an average starting salary ranging from ₹4 LPA to ₹7 LPA. With 3-5 years of experience, this can rise to ₹8 LPA to ₹15 LPA. Senior professionals with over 10 years of experience and specialized skills can command salaries exceeding ₹20 LPA.
